HTTP अनुरोध और प्रतिक्रिया

From binaryoption
Revision as of 09:47, 19 April 2025 by Admin (talk | contribs) (@pipegas_WP-test)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
Баннер1

HTTP अनुरोध और प्रतिक्रिया

परिचय

HTTP (हाइपरटेक्स्ट ट्रांसफर प्रोटोकॉल) वेब पर डेटा संचार का आधार है। यह प्रोटोकॉल क्लाइंट (जैसे वेब ब्राउज़र) और सर्वर (जैसे वेब सर्वर) के बीच संचार को परिभाषित करता है। MediaWiki, अपने कोर में, HTTP प्रोटोकॉल पर निर्भर करता है ताकि उपयोगकर्ताओं को वेब पेज प्रदर्शित किए जा सकें और उपयोगकर्ता इनपुट को संसाधित किया जा सके। बाइनरी ऑप्शन ट्रेडिंग प्लेटफ़ॉर्म भी HTTP का उपयोग अपने सर्वरों के साथ संचार करने के लिए करते हैं, जिससे वास्तविक समय के डेटा को प्राप्त किया जा सके और ट्रेडों को निष्पादित किया जा सके। यह लेख MediaWiki 1.40 के संदर्भ में HTTP अनुरोधों और प्रतिक्रियाओं की विस्तृत व्याख्या प्रदान करता है, और बाइनरी ऑप्शन ट्रेडिंग में HTTP के उपयोग को भी छूता है।

HTTP अनुरोध

एक HTTP अनुरोध क्लाइंट द्वारा सर्वर को भेजा गया एक संदेश है, जो किसी विशिष्ट क्रिया को करने का अनुरोध करता है। एक विशिष्ट HTTP अनुरोध में निम्नलिखित घटक होते हैं:

  • विधि (Method): अनुरोध करने के लिए क्रिया निर्दिष्ट करता है, जैसे कि GET (डेटा प्राप्त करना), POST (डेटा भेजना), PUT (डेटा अपडेट करना), DELETE (डेटा हटाना), आदि।
  • URI (Uniform Resource Identifier): सर्वर पर अनुरोधित संसाधन की पहचान करता है।
  • HTTP संस्करण (HTTP Version): उपयोग किए जा रहे HTTP प्रोटोकॉल का संस्करण निर्दिष्ट करता है (जैसे HTTP/1.1, HTTP/2)।
  • शीर्षक (Headers): क्लाइंट और अनुरोध के बारे में अतिरिक्त जानकारी प्रदान करते हैं, जैसे कि सामग्री प्रकार, भाषा प्राथमिकताएं, और प्रमाणीकरण जानकारी।
  • बॉडी (Body): अनुरोध के साथ भेजा गया कोई भी डेटा, जैसे कि POST अनुरोध में फॉर्म डेटा।

MediaWiki में, जब आप किसी पेज को देखते हैं, तो आपका ब्राउज़र सर्वर को एक GET अनुरोध भेजता है, जिसमें पेज का URI होता है। जब आप एक पेज संपादित करते हैं, तो आपका ब्राउज़र सर्वर को एक POST अनुरोध भेजता है, जिसमें संपादित डेटा बॉडी में होता है।

बाइनरी ऑप्शन ट्रेडिंग में, HTTP अनुरोधों का उपयोग तकनीकी विश्लेषण डेटा, ट्रेडिंग वॉल्यूम डेटा और संकेतक डेटा प्राप्त करने के लिए किया जाता है। उदाहरण के लिए, एक ट्रेडिंग प्लेटफ़ॉर्म सर्वर को एक अनुरोध भेज सकता है ताकि किसी विशेष संपत्ति के लिए वर्तमान मूल्य प्राप्त किया जा सके।

HTTP अनुरोध विधियाँ
विधि विवरण MediaWiki उदाहरण बाइनरी ऑप्शन उदाहरण
GET सर्वर से डेटा प्राप्त करता है। किसी पेज को देखना। संपत्ति का वर्तमान मूल्य प्राप्त करना।
POST सर्वर पर डेटा भेजता है। पेज संपादित करना, फॉर्म सबमिट करना। ट्रेड निष्पादित करना।
PUT सर्वर पर डेटा अपडेट करता है। (MediaWiki में कम उपयोग) (बाइनरी ऑप्शन में कम उपयोग)
DELETE सर्वर से डेटा हटाता है। (MediaWiki में कम उपयोग) (बाइनरी ऑप्शन में कम उपयोग)

HTTP प्रतिक्रिया

एक HTTP प्रतिक्रिया सर्वर द्वारा क्लाइंट को भेजा गया एक संदेश है, जो अनुरोध का उत्तर देता है। एक विशिष्ट HTTP प्रतिक्रिया में निम्नलिखित घटक होते हैं:

  • स्थिति कोड (Status Code): अनुरोध की सफलता या विफलता को इंगित करता है। 200-299 की स्थिति कोड सफलता को इंगित करते हैं, जबकि 400-599 की स्थिति कोड त्रुटियों को इंगित करते हैं।
  • शीर्षक (Headers): सर्वर और प्रतिक्रिया के बारे में अतिरिक्त जानकारी प्रदान करते हैं, जैसे कि सामग्री प्रकार, सामग्री लंबाई, और सर्वर जानकारी।
  • बॉडी (Body): अनुरोधित डेटा, जैसे कि HTML पेज, JSON डेटा, या छवि।

MediaWiki में, जब आप एक पेज का अनुरोध करते हैं, तो सर्वर एक HTTP प्रतिक्रिया भेजता है जिसमें HTML कोड बॉडी में होता है। यदि अनुरोध सफल होता है, तो प्रतिक्रिया में 200 स्थिति कोड होगा। यदि अनुरोध विफल हो जाता है, तो प्रतिक्रिया में एक त्रुटि स्थिति कोड होगा, जैसे कि 404 (पेज नहीं मिला) या 500 (सर्वर त्रुटि)।

बाइनरी ऑप्शन ट्रेडिंग में, HTTP प्रतिक्रियाओं का उपयोग ट्रेडिंग रणनीति परिणामों, बाजार के रुझान डेटा और सिग्नल डेटा प्राप्त करने के लिए किया जाता है। उदाहरण के लिए, जब आप एक ट्रेड निष्पादित करते हैं, तो सर्वर एक HTTP प्रतिक्रिया भेज सकता है जिसमें ट्रेड की स्थिति (सफल या असफल) शामिल होती है।

सामान्य HTTP स्थिति कोड
कोड विवरण MediaWiki उदाहरण बाइनरी ऑप्शन उदाहरण
200 ठीक (OK) पेज सफलतापूर्वक लोड हुआ। ट्रेड सफलतापूर्वक निष्पादित हुआ।
301 स्थायी रूप से स्थानांतरित (Moved Permanently) पेज एक नए URL पर स्थानांतरित हो गया है। (बाइनरी ऑप्शन में कम उपयोग)
400 खराब अनुरोध (Bad Request) अनुरोध अमान्य है। अमान्य ट्रेड पैरामीटर।
404 नहीं मिला (Not Found) अनुरोधित संसाधन नहीं मिला। अनुरोधित डेटा उपलब्ध नहीं है।
500 आंतरिक सर्वर त्रुटि (Internal Server Error) सर्वर पर त्रुटि हुई। सर्वर त्रुटि के कारण ट्रेड निष्पादित करने में विफल।

MediaWiki में HTTP का उपयोग

MediaWiki विभिन्न तरीकों से HTTP का उपयोग करता है:

  • पेज अनुरोध: जब आप किसी पेज का अनुरोध करते हैं, तो MediaWiki सर्वर एक HTTP प्रतिक्रिया भेजता है जिसमें HTML कोड बॉडी में होता है।
  • फॉर्म सबमिशन: जब आप एक फॉर्म सबमिट करते हैं, तो MediaWiki सर्वर एक HTTP POST अनुरोध प्राप्त करता है और डेटा को संसाधित करता है।
  • API अनुरोध: MediaWiki एक API प्रदान करता है जिसका उपयोग बाहरी एप्लिकेशन MediaWiki डेटा तक पहुंचने और हेरफेर करने के लिए कर सकते हैं। API अनुरोध HTTP अनुरोधों का उपयोग करते हैं।
  • एक्सटेंशन: MediaWiki एक्सटेंशन HTTP अनुरोधों का उपयोग बाहरी सेवाओं के साथ एकीकृत करने के लिए कर सकते हैं।

उदाहरण के लिए, VisualEditor एक्सटेंशन संपादन प्रक्रिया को सरल बनाने के लिए HTTP अनुरोधों का उपयोग करता है। REST API का उपयोग बाहरी एप्लिकेशन को MediaWiki डेटा तक पहुंचने की अनुमति देता है।

बाइनरी ऑप्शन ट्रेडिंग में HTTP का उपयोग

बाइनरी ऑप्शन ट्रेडिंग प्लेटफ़ॉर्म HTTP का उपयोग विभिन्न कार्यों के लिए करते हैं:

  • वास्तविक समय डेटा: HTTP अनुरोधों का उपयोग संपत्ति की कीमतों, ट्रेडिंग वॉल्यूम और अन्य बाजार डेटा को वास्तविक समय में प्राप्त करने के लिए किया जाता है।
  • ट्रेड निष्पादन: HTTP अनुरोधों का उपयोग ट्रेडों को निष्पादित करने और ट्रेड की स्थिति प्राप्त करने के लिए किया जाता है।
  • खाता प्रबंधन: HTTP अनुरोधों का उपयोग खाते की जानकारी को प्रबंधित करने, जमा करने और निकालने के लिए किया जाता है।
  • API एकीकरण: बाइनरी ऑप्शन प्लेटफ़ॉर्म बाहरी सेवाओं के साथ एकीकृत करने के लिए API प्रदान करते हैं, जो HTTP अनुरोधों का उपयोग करते हैं।

उदाहरण के लिए, Olymp Trade, IQ Option और Binary.com जैसे प्लेटफ़ॉर्म सभी HTTP का उपयोग अपने सर्वरों के साथ संचार करने के लिए करते हैं। ट्रेडिंग बॉट HTTP API का उपयोग स्वचालित ट्रेडों को निष्पादित करने के लिए करते हैं। तकनीकी संकेतक डेटा प्राप्त करने के लिए HTTP अनुरोधों का उपयोग किया जाता है, जैसे कि मूविंग एवरेज, RSI और MACDजोखिम प्रबंधन रणनीतियों को लागू करने के लिए HTTP डेटा का उपयोग किया जाता है। मनी मैनेजमेंट तकनीकों को स्वचालित करने के लिए HTTP API का उपयोग किया जा सकता है। ट्रेडिंग मनोविज्ञान को समझने के लिए HTTP डेटा का विश्लेषण किया जा सकता है। मार्केट सेंटीमेंट को मापने के लिए HTTP डेटा का उपयोग किया जा सकता है। उच्च आवृत्ति ट्रेडिंग (HFT) में HTTP की गति और विश्वसनीयता महत्वपूर्ण है। अल्गोरिदमिक ट्रेडिंग HTTP API पर निर्भर करता है। आर्बिट्राज अवसरों की पहचान करने के लिए HTTP डेटा का उपयोग किया जा सकता है। पैटर्न पहचान रणनीतियों के लिए HTTP डेटा आवश्यक है। स्कैल्पिंग में त्वरित प्रतिक्रिया के लिए HTTP महत्वपूर्ण है। डे ट्रेडिंग के लिए HTTP डेटा महत्वपूर्ण है। स्विंग ट्रेडिंग के लिए HTTP डेटा का उपयोग किया जा सकता है। लॉन्ग टर्म इन्वेस्टिंग के लिए HTTP डेटा का उपयोग किया जा सकता है। पोर्टफोलियो अनुकूलन के लिए HTTP डेटा का उपयोग किया जा सकता है। बाइनरी ऑप्शन डेमो अकाउंट भी HTTP के माध्यम से डेटा प्राप्त करते हैं।

सुरक्षा विचार

HTTP संचार को सुरक्षित करने के लिए, HTTPS (HTTP Secure) का उपयोग किया जाना चाहिए। HTTPS HTTP का एक सुरक्षित संस्करण है जो SSL/TLS एन्क्रिप्शन का उपयोग करता है। MediaWiki को HTTPS का उपयोग करने के लिए कॉन्फ़िगर किया जा सकता है। बाइनरी ऑप्शन ट्रेडिंग प्लेटफ़ॉर्म को भी HTTPS का उपयोग करना चाहिए ताकि उपयोगकर्ताओं की संवेदनशील जानकारी को सुरक्षित रखा जा सके। फायरवॉल और इंट्रूज़न डिटेक्शन सिस्टम का उपयोग HTTP हमलों से बचाने के लिए किया जा सकता है। क्रॉस-साइट स्क्रिप्टिंग (XSS) और एसक्यूएल इंजेक्शन जैसे हमलों से सुरक्षा के लिए उचित सुरक्षा उपाय किए जाने चाहिए।

निष्कर्ष

HTTP वेब पर डेटा संचार का एक मूलभूत प्रोटोकॉल है। MediaWiki और बाइनरी ऑप्शन ट्रेडिंग प्लेटफ़ॉर्म दोनों ही HTTP पर निर्भर करते हैं ताकि वे ठीक से काम कर सकें। HTTP अनुरोधों और प्रतिक्रियाओं को समझना इन प्रणालियों को समझने के लिए आवश्यक है। सुरक्षा विचारों को ध्यान में रखना महत्वपूर्ण है ताकि डेटा को सुरक्षित रखा जा सके।

अभी ट्रेडिंग शुरू करें

IQ Option पर रजिस्टर करें (न्यूनतम जमा ₹750) Pocket Option में खाता खोलें (न्यूनतम जमा ₹400)

हमारे समुदाय में शामिल हों

हमारे Telegram चैनल @strategybin को सब्सक्राइब करें और प्राप्त करें: ✓ दैनिक ट्रेडिंग सिग्नल ✓ विशेष रणनीति विश्लेषण ✓ बाजार के ट्रेंड्स की अलर्ट ✓ शुरुआती लोगों के लिए शैक्षिक सामग्री

Баннер